Ellen Rose Noble (born December 3, 1995) is a retired American professional racing cyclist,[1] who last rode for Trek Factory Racing in cyclo-cross and mountain bike racing. In 2019, Noble was named as part of UCI Women's Team Trek–Segafredo for the women's road cycling season.[2]
